Jean Alfred Gagné

Jean-Alfred Gagné (April 17, 1842 – August 8, 1910) was a lawyer, merchant, judge and political figure in Quebec.

He was born in La Malbaie, Canada East, the son of Jean Gagné and Christine Blackburn[1] and was educated at the Seminaire de Québec.

Gagné was called to the Lower Canada bar in 1864 and set up practice in Chicoutimi.

In 1889, he was named a judge in the Quebec Superior Court for Chicoutimi district.
